To wash your truck at home, you’ll need the following:
Step 1: Pre-Rinse
Using the pressure washer, rinse the entire truck to remove loose dirt and debris. Work from top to bottom and from the inside out for best results.
Step 2: Wash the Body
Mix the car wash soap with water in a bucket according to the product instructions. Dip a wash mitt into the soapy water, wring it out, and gently wash the truck’s body. Work in sections, from top to bottom and front to back.
Step 3: Clean the Undercarriage
The undercarriage is exposed to dirt and grime, requiring thorough cleaning. Use the pressure washer to blast away dirt and debris from the undercarriage.
Step 4: Wash the Tires
Use a tire brush to scrub the tires, removing dirt and grime from the treads and sidewalls. Rinse thoroughly with the pressure washer.
Step 5: Dry the Truck
Use a clean, dry microfiber towel to dry the entire truck. Work from top to bottom to prevent water spots.
Step 6: Clean the Interior
Vacuum and wipe down the interior, including the dashboard, seats, and floor mats. Use a dedicated interior cleaner for best results.
